Kaltura Unveils AI Innovations at IBC 2026 to Revolutionize Media Engagement and Monetization
September 7, 2026
Kaltura is rolling out a broad suite of AI-powered innovations at IBC 2026 in Amsterdam, designed to boost content discovery, viewer engagement, accessibility, and monetization for media companies and telecom operators.
Executives emphasize a unified, scalable experience that combines discovery, engagement, accessibility, and monetization for viewers, operators, and broadcasters.
The innovations aim to enable smarter subscriber interactions across the entire lifecycle, from discovery and viewing to support and retention, while expanding accessibility and new revenue opportunities.

The AI-powered Cloud TV platform will showcase conversational content discovery, personalized recommendations and dynamic rails, unified search with deep linking, and AI-driven video enrichment like dubbing, subtitles, chapters, highlights, and automated metadata.
New capabilities debuting at IBC include intelligent automation, new conversational agents, enhanced customer care, personalized monetization, a sports assistant, AI-driven staff training, a next-gen front-end UI, vertical video and AI-generated micro dramas, and on-screen sign language for accessibility.
